Democrats balk at pope's comments, again USAToday A group of 18 Catholic House Democrats publicly disputed Pope Benedict XVI's recent condemnation of Mexican politicians who support abortion rights, saying that "such notions offend the very nature of the American experiment." Catholic Democrats who are pro-abortion have balked at this teaching of the Church for some time. OSV published an editorial on the subject in our May 27 edition.
Russian Orthodox churches reunite BBC.com The Russian Orthodox Church Abroad has reunited with the Russian Orthodox Church after 80 years of schism sparked by the Bolshevik revolution. Talks to re-establish ties between the Russian Orthodox Church in exile and its mother church began soon after the collapse of the USSR, which ignited a revival of organized religion in Russia.
Choosing abortion to save scholarships Concord Monitor Many colleges and universities have policies requiring female athletes lose scholarships if they get pregnant. Under these rules, women are choosing abortions over the prospect of losing money for tuition. Dropping scholarships for this reason "is an entirely legal thing and within NCAA rules," said Barbara Osborne, a lawyer and assistant professor of sports law research at the University of North Carolina at Chapel Hill. But many schools continue scholarships for students temporarily sidelined by accidents, illness or other medical conditions, Osborne said, and some are developing programs to assist pregnant athletes to help them stay in college.
